In today's reading we will read Psalm 44:1-8, Psalm 107:1-31, and Psalm 118:1, 5-6, 8-16, 19-24, 28-29. There is a central theme throughout the three psalms that we read today: Let us praise God, who saves us and whose love for us lasts forever. Wherever we are, whatever happens, God is with us and saves us! Let us be glad, praise Him, and thank Him for the wonderful things He does! God loves us so much He even sent Jesus to die for us, to pay the cost for our sins. All have sinned and fall short of the glory of God and Jesus saved us from spiritual death and separation from God. Old and New Covenant Discussion

00:02:16
Speaker
It's a little more accurate to say covenant versus testament because that's what they were. The first section of the Bible was considered, is considered, God's old covenant, his first covenant that he made with his people.
00:02:32
Speaker
And when he had Jesus come for us, that is his new covenant. So I just try to be a little more precise there. So today we are going to be reading some beautiful Psalms.
